"tas" meaning in Bahasa Melayu

See tas in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Forms: تس [Jawi]
Etymology: Daripada bahasa Belanda tas, daripada bahasa Middle Dutch tassche, tasche, daripada bahasa Belanda Kuno, daripada bahasa Jermanik Purba *taskǭ.
  1. Beg kecil yang dibawa dengan tangan.
